0
  • 聊天消息
  • 系统消息
  • 评论与回复
登录后你可以
  • 下载海量资料
  • 学习在线课程
  • 观看技术视频
  • 写文章/发帖/加入社区
会员中心
创作中心

完善资料让更多小伙伴认识你,还能领取20积分哦,立即完善>

3天内不再提示

基于Label CIFAR10 image on FRDM-MCXN947例程实现鞋和帽子的识别

安富利 来源:与非网 2025-01-13 09:18 次阅读
加入交流群
微信小助手二维码

扫码添加小助手

加入工程师交流群

前言

恩智浦“FRDM-MCXN947”评测活动由安富利和与非网协同举办。本篇内容由与非网用户发布,已授权转载许可。原文可在与非网(eefocus)工程师社区查看。

PART01 NXP FRDM-MCXN947: 物体识别

感谢这次评测活动,收到FRDM-MCXN947的板子。NXP官方提供了很多视觉识别的例程,今天我们就基于Label CIFAR10 image on FRDM-MCXN947例程实现鞋和帽子的识别。

启动eiq,选择导入

993367da-ce68-11ef-9310-92fbcf53809c.jpg

选择图片导入

9940862c-ce68-11ef-9310-92fbcf53809c.jpg

导入图片

995c76c0-ce68-11ef-9310-92fbcf53809c.jpg

准备训练

996803e6-ce68-11ef-9310-92fbcf53809c.jpg

训练结果

997a9d80-ce68-11ef-9310-92fbcf53809c.jpg

验证一下训练模型

998eb1bc-ce68-11ef-9310-92fbcf53809c.jpg

模型结构

99a70924-ce68-11ef-9310-92fbcf53809c.jpg

转换模型

99bcf6bc-ce68-11ef-9310-92fbcf53809c.jpg

转换出来的模型结构

99d4f1d6-ce68-11ef-9310-92fbcf53809c.jpg

部署到单片机

替换模型

修改代码

static const char* labels[] = {
    "hat",
    "shoes",
    "          "
};

运行效果

(1)识别鞋子

99ea1e94-ce68-11ef-9310-92fbcf53809c.jpg

(2)空识别

9a04594e-ce68-11ef-9310-92fbcf53809c.jpg

(3)识别帽子

9a1bef78-ce68-11ef-9310-92fbcf53809c.jpg

PART02 NXP FRDM-MCXN947: 驱动LCD-PAR-S035模块

今天我们拿使用N947驱动一下NXP的LCD-PAR-S035模块,做一个简单的上手教程

首先启动MCUXpresso Config Tools,选择例程,这里我直接使用lvgl的例程

9a39c0e8-ce68-11ef-9310-92fbcf53809c.png

出现这个窗口直接关闭就可以

9a56f442-ce68-11ef-9310-92fbcf53809c.png

下面的IO配置为调试串口

9a648904-ce68-11ef-9310-92fbcf53809c.png

在上面切换配置选项

9a797c7e-ce68-11ef-9310-92fbcf53809c.png

这里可以看到对LCD相关的IO的配置

9a8d6e5a-ce68-11ef-9310-92fbcf53809c.png

打开工程,需要对工程做一点修改

在这里将BOARD_LCD_S035修改为1

9abafb68-ce68-11ef-9310-92fbcf53809c.png

接好屏幕,注意方向

9ac60652-ce68-11ef-9310-92fbcf53809c.jpg

编译下载后即可看到效果

9ad92d04-ce68-11ef-9310-92fbcf53809c.jpg

文章来源:

【Avnet | NXP FRDM-MCXN947试用活动】物体识别

https://www.eefocus.com/forum/forum.php?mod=viewthread&tid=231669

【Avnet | NXP FRDM-MCXN947试用活动】驱动LCD-PAR-S035模块

https://www.eefocus.com/forum/forum.php?mod=viewthread&tid=231702

END

声明:本文内容及配图由入驻作者撰写或者入驻合作网站授权转载。文章观点仅代表作者本人,不代表电子发烧友网立场。文章及其配图仅供工程师学习之用,如有内容侵权或者其他违规问题,请联系本站处理。 举报投诉
  • NXP
    NXP
    +关注

    关注

    61

    文章

    1377

    浏览量

    194767
  • 板卡
    +关注

    关注

    3

    文章

    167

    浏览量

    17430

原文标题:用户测评(一):使用NXP MCX-N板卡实现鞋帽等物件识别

文章出处:【微信号:AvnetAsia,微信公众号:安富利】欢迎添加关注!文章转载请注明出处。

收藏 人收藏
加入交流群
微信小助手二维码

扫码添加小助手

加入工程师交流群

    评论

    相关推荐
    热点推荐

    如何在MCXN947微控制器上配置安全启动和生命周期

    本文档旨在介绍如何在MCXN947微控制器上配置安全启动和生命周期,以确保产品在量产阶段的安全性,防止代码被窃取和篡改,并且能够安全地升级更新固件。通过本应用笔记,开发者可以更好地理解和实施安全启动和固件更新的最佳实践。
    的头像 发表于 06-26 09:49 2080次阅读
    如何在<b class='flag-5'>MCXN947</b>微控制器上配置安全启动和生命周期

    如何在MCXN947板的FlexSPI接口接HyperRAM

    MCXN947芯片是一款高度集成的微控制器,具有强大的处理能力、丰富的外设支持和高级安全特性,适用于多种复杂应用。其中有个非常重要的外设为FlexSPI。
    的头像 发表于 06-04 09:39 1730次阅读
    如何在<b class='flag-5'>MCXN947</b>板的FlexSPI接口接HyperRAM

    MCXN947怎么驱动FRDM-STBI-A8974三轴陀螺仪?

    MCXN947怎么驱动FRDM-STBI-A8974三轴陀螺仪
    发表于 04-14 10:50

    在恩智浦FRDM-MCXN947开发板部署DeepSeek大语言模型

    还在羡慕那些动辄几十GB显存的AI大佬?今天,我们用一块小小的FRDM-MCXN947开发板,就能让你体验到与大语言模型畅聊的快感!谁说嵌入式设备只能闪烁LED?今天我们就要让它"口吐莲花"!
    的头像 发表于 04-10 17:23 3269次阅读
    在恩智浦<b class='flag-5'>FRDM-MCXN947</b>开发板部署DeepSeek大语言模型

    《恩智浦FRDM-MCXA156开发实践指南》上线啦

    ,完成了电子书《恩智浦FRDM-MCXA156开发实践指南》,希望能够给大家提供一些支持。《恩智浦FRDM-MCXN947开发实践指南》包含的内容以及对应的贡献者
    的头像 发表于 04-06 10:51 2652次阅读
    《恩智浦<b class='flag-5'>FRDM</b>-MCXA156开发实践指南》上线啦

    MCXN947如何配置和外扩PSRAM?

    mcxn947自带的ram太小了,无法满足需求,想外扩一块psram,比如乐鑫的esp-psram64芯片,这个需求有哪个案例可以参考吗?
    发表于 03-31 06:54

    如何在NXP MCU上启用D-Cache?

    我正在 NXP FRDM-MCXN947 MCU 上测试 TFLite AI 模型的推理时间和性能。虽然我使用 NPU 获得了良好的性能,但在不使用 NPU 时,我的推理时间相对较慢。通过启用
    发表于 03-27 07:48

    FRDM-MCXN947在初始化lpI2C时, I2C无法正常工作怎么解决?

    我正在使用 FRDM-MCXN947 开发板,发现在初始化 lpI2C 时, I2C 无法正常工作。我的配置如图所示。 我使用的配置基于演示。您能帮我检查一下问题可能是什么吗?谢谢。
    发表于 03-25 06:32

    FRDM-MCXN947为什么无法使用配置工具修改示例项目中使用的led_blinky LED?

    MCXN947板的SDK。(我在 intel iMac 上运行它。 2. 导入、构建并运行 led_blinky 示例项目。这很好用。 3. 在 VSCode 中,右键单击 led_blinky 并开始使用
    发表于 03-24 07:59

    MCXN947使用ADC并编写代码,总是报警告是怎么回事?

    我使用 MCXN947,我想使用 ADC 并编写代码,但警告总是发生。然后我创建了一个新项目进行调试,它仍然发生了。 我试着打扫,但还是没用。 警告:无法将 \'main\' 从主机编码 (CP1252) 转换为 UTF-32。 这通常不会发生,请提交 bug 报告。
    发表于 03-20 08:17

    FRDM-MCXN236使用irtc示例代码演示RTC,在配置使用外部32.768Khz OSC时出现问题怎么解决?

    我正在使用 FRDM-MCXN236,我尝试使用 irtc 示例代码演示 RTC,但在配置使用外部 32.768Khz OSC 时出现问题、 问题如图,请帮助建议解决。
    发表于 03-17 07:24

    使用FRDM-MXCN947板,在MCUXpresso IDE中调试期间尝试从下载写入QSPI闪存出现报错的原因?

    我正在使用 FRDM-MXCN947 板,并在 MCUXpresso IDE 中调试期间尝试从下载写入 QSPI 闪存,但出现以下错误。 闪存驱动程序使用 MCXN9xx_SFDP_FlexSPI.cfx。 我需要修改驱动程序吗? 谢谢。
    发表于 03-17 07:13

    关于将Flash写入FRDM-MCXN947的问题求解

    这次我想问一个关于使用 MCXN947 将 Flash 写入另一个板的问题。 我尝试使用 FRDM-MCXN947 的写入方法作为参考写入此板,但发生了错误。 下面是当时控制台的内容。 NXP
    发表于 03-17 06:29

    使用NXP MCX-N板卡搭建环境及点灯

    器件提供了硬件评估板、软件开发IDE、示例程序和驱动的支持。 FRDM-MCXN947开发板由一个MCXN947器件组成,配备了64Mbit的外部串行闪存。
    的头像 发表于 02-12 09:07 1676次阅读
    使用NXP MCX-N板卡搭建环境及点灯

    用户测评之体验NXP MCX-N板卡的NPU功能

    前言 恩智浦“FRDM-MCXN947”评测活动由安富利和与非网协同举办。 01 NXP FRDM-MCXN947: HMI初体验 N947是NXP推出的MCX系列带NPU的一款产品,主推市场之一
    的头像 发表于 01-17 10:27 1664次阅读
    用户测评之体验NXP MCX-N板卡的NPU功能